Victimising labour [Pakistan]

Prime Minister Yousuf Raza Gillani...expressed his government's resolve...to revise anti-workers legislation. But...in Lahore...A labour leader...was arrested...charges of dacoity...His real crime, however, was that he assisted the disorganised workers of a firm to form their first trade union...What are the legal safeguards available to workers to limit the arbitrary power used against them when they attempt to build trade unions in their factories and industries? Without these issues being taken up, any labour policy proposed by the government will remain incomplete.
